Department of Homeland Security Secretary Markwayne Mullin appeared before the House Homeland Security Committee this week and delivered a progress report that is likely to infuriate open-border activists and Biden allies who spent years attacking border barrier construction.

Mullin offered lawmakers a clear timeline for when Americans can expect major portions of the southern border security system to be completed.

According to the DHS chief, the primary border barrier stretching from the Pacific coastline to the Gulf of America is on pace to be finished by June 2027. He also stated that every remaining contract tied to the project is expected to be awarded before the end of the month.

The secondary barrier system, designed to strengthen vulnerable sections where criminal organizations have repeatedly breached existing infrastructure, is projected to be completed by the summer of 2028.

“We’re well within track,” Mullin said. “All of it will be fully completed.”
